The process for mesothelioma lawsuits is different from state to state. However, the majority of lawsuits be settled prior to reaching the trial stage. Settlements are reached when both sides agree on a figure to pay the victim for their losses. Compensation includes both economic damages as well as non-economic damage. Economic damages include treatment expenses, lost income and other expenses that are documented. Non-economic damages include physical pain and mesothelioma litigation mental suffering.

A lawsuit against asbestos-related companies is filed to hold them responsible for the harm they cause. The two primary types of mesothelioma lawsuits are personal injury and wrongful death. Both require compensation for mesothelioma victims and their families, however the personal injury claim can be resolved faster than a wrongful death suit.

Mesothelioma victims can receive compensation from three sources: asbestos trust funds, lawsuits and settlements. Asbestos trust funds are set up by bankrupt asbestos companies to ensure their victims and their families receive compensation for asbestos-related illnesses. A successful mesothelioma compensation claim can award victims in 90 days or less. The amount of compensation awarded will depend on a number of factors that include how the case is reviewed and the mesothelioma trust fund to file with. The expedited review process provides a rapid payment to those who satisfy predetermined criteria, whereas individual reviews look at the case in greater depth.

The length of a mesothelioma claim can differ based on the compensation sought. In many cases, the defendants in mesothelioma lawsuits will agree to settle to avoid expensive litigation and the risk of losing the entire case. However, if the defendants aren't willing to settle, it could take longer than a year before the trial verdict is made.

If a jury finds that the defendants are accountable, they will pay compensation to the victim and their family. Compensation is usually paid in monthly installments, instead of a lump sum.
